Show Notes
This podcast serves as a comprehensive guide to the squat exercise, explaining its benefits for muscle growth, athleticism, and strength. It details the underlying physics and anatomy involved in the movement, breaking down how different body parts contribute. The source provides in-depth information on proper technique, including setup, descent, and ascent, discussing variations in bar placement, stance, and bracing. Finally, it addresses common questions and issues related to squatting, such as safety, mobility limitations, form variations, and injury concerns.
